Default Arabic & Roman numbering in Brief with TOC and Tab. of Authorities

I am trying to number a long legal brief that needs to have a cover page with
no number. The next 2 pages are numbered C-1 of 2 and C-2 of 2. The next
several pages need small Roman numerals (the TOC and TOA). The rest of the
brief needs to have Arabic numerals. In the past, we divided each section
into a separate document. Now, they have to be filed electronically with the
court as one document. Thanks.
